首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

被动记录应用程序在生产中的性能

是指通过监控和记录应用程序在生产环境中的性能指标和行为,以便进行性能分析和优化的过程。这种记录通常是自动化的,通过收集和分析大量的数据来评估应用程序的性能,并提供有关性能瓶颈和改进机会的洞察。

被动记录应用程序的性能对于开发工程师和云计算专家来说非常重要,因为它可以帮助他们识别和解决应用程序中的性能问题,提高用户体验和系统的可靠性。以下是关于被动记录应用程序性能的一些重要概念和相关信息:

  1. 性能指标:被动记录应用程序性能的关键是收集和分析各种性能指标。这些指标可以包括响应时间、吞吐量、并发用户数、CPU和内存使用率等。通过监控这些指标,可以了解应用程序的性能状况,并及时发现潜在的性能问题。
  2. 性能监控工具:为了实现被动记录应用程序的性能,可以使用各种性能监控工具。这些工具可以实时监控应用程序的性能指标,并将数据记录到日志或数据库中,以供后续分析和优化。一些常用的性能监控工具包括Prometheus、Grafana、New Relic等。
  3. 性能分析:被动记录应用程序的性能数据后,需要进行性能分析来识别潜在的性能问题和瓶颈。性能分析可以通过统计分析、数据可视化和模型建立等方法来实现。通过性能分析,可以找到性能瓶颈并提出相应的优化建议。
  4. 性能优化:被动记录应用程序的性能是为了进行性能优化。性能优化可以包括代码优化、数据库调优、缓存优化、负载均衡等方面的工作。通过优化应用程序的性能,可以提高系统的响应速度和吞吐量,提升用户体验。
  5. 应用场景:被动记录应用程序的性能适用于任何需要关注应用程序性能的场景。无论是Web应用程序、移动应用程序还是企业级应用程序,都可以通过被动记录应用程序的性能来进行性能监控和优化。

腾讯云相关产品和产品介绍链接地址:

请注意,以上只是一些示例链接,腾讯云还提供了更多与被动记录应用程序性能相关的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Groovy结合Java在生产中落地实战

Groovy简介 Groovy是用于Java虚拟机一种敏捷动态语言,是一种成熟面向对象编程语言,又是一种纯粹脚本语言。...同时又具有闭包和动态语言中其他特性,弥补了单纯Java代码所不具备动态性,我们可以在程序运行时任意修改代码逻辑,不需要重新发布。...直接抛场景 以下是一个JSON字符串 { "routeId": "A", "settingKey": 2, "memberId": 1 } 如果我现在有一个诉求是根据routId路由不同下游分支...如果我现在JSON变为下面这种情况,上面的代码是否就不合适了呢?...} } 现在我定义一个规则 ['136001002'].contains(root.productId.toString()) 现在我想把这个规则生成一个AbstractFilterFlowNode实现类

13600

SpringBoot 在生产中 16 条最佳实践

哈喽,小伙伴们好,我是狗哥,今天聊聊 SpringBoot 在生产中实践。 Spring Boot 是最流行用于开发微服务Java框架。...理想情况下,你不希望服务知道它正在与哪个数据库通信,这需要一些抽象来封装对象持久性。 罗伯特C.马丁强烈地说明,你数据库是一个“细节”,这意味着不将你应用程序与特定数据库耦合。...12 加强配置管理外部化 这一点超出了Spring Boot,虽然这是人们开始创建多个类似服务时常见问题…… 你可以手动处理Spring应用程序配置。...只需获取该类记录器实例: Logger logger = LoggerFactory.getLogger(MyClass.class); 这很重要,因为它可以让你根据需要设置不同日志记录级别。...使用测试切片,你可以根据需要仅连接部分应用程序。这可以为你节省大量时间,并确保你测试不会与未使用内容相关联。

54220
  • 安灯电子看板系统在生产中优势

    安灯电子看板系统在在生产中优势*初是应用在汽车生产装配线中,到目前为止,安灯电子看板系统在在生产中优势软件在其他机械制造以及装配线上也得到进一步推广与运用。...安灯电子看板系统在在生产中优势优势顾问咨询更可以帮助用户从战略、流程、管理与资源角度梳理思路,为安灯电子看板系统在生产中优势优势实施奠定良好基础。...制造行业安灯电子看板系统在在生产中优势优势中,按照车身—油漆—总装工艺流程可以在多个关键岗位和各车间出口、入口部署安灯电子看板系统在在生产中优势优势现场点客户端,用来进行现场操作。...安灯电子看板系统在在生产中优势已经广泛应用于各行各业智能仓储、智慧物流,极大提高了工作效率及降低出错率。...以上就是"安灯电子看板系统在在生产中优势"全部内容,如果需要了解更多安灯电子看板系统在在生产中优势相关信息,请访问其它页面或直接与我们联系。

    36900

    Flink CheckPoint奇巧 | 原理和在生产中应用

    来源:暴走大数据 作者:王知无 By 暴走大数据 场景描述:Flink本身为了保证其高可用特性,以及保证作用Exactly Once快速恢复,进而提供了一套强大Checkpoint机制。...有哪些需要注意呢? 关键词:Flink CheckPoint Flink本身为了保证其高可用特性,以及保证作用Exactly Once快速恢复,进而提供了一套强大Checkpoint机制。...后来我们意识到在大部分情况下这是不必要,因为上一次和这次检查点之前 ,状态发生了很大变化,所以我们创建了“增量式检查点”。增量式检查点仅保存过去和现在状态差异部分。...由于‘CP2’对应 文件引用计数达到0,这些文件将被删除。 需要注意地方 如果使用增量式checkpoint,那么在错误恢复时候,不需要考虑很多配置项。...总的来说,增量式减少了checkpoint操作时间,但是相对,从checkpoint中恢复可能更耗时,具体情况需要根据应用程序包含状态大小而定。

    1.6K51

    安灯电子看板系统在在生产中优势

    安灯电子看板系统在在生产中优势是企业信息化建设重要组成部分。...安灯电子看板系统在在生产中优势*初是应用在汽车生产装配线中,到目前为止,安灯电子看板系统在在生产中优势软件在其他机械制造以及装配线上也得到进一步推广与运用。...安灯电子看板系统在在生产中优势优势顾问咨询更可以帮助用户从战略、流程、管理与资源角度梳理思路,为安灯电子看板系统在在生产中优势优势实施奠定良好基础。...制造行业安灯电子看板系统在在生产中优势优势中,按照车身—油漆—总装工艺流程可以在多个关键岗位和各车间出口、入口部署安灯电子看板系统在在生产中优势优势现场点客户端,用来进行现场操作。...以上就是"安灯电子看板系统在在生产中优势"全部内容,如果需要了解更多安灯电子看板系统在在生产中优势相关信息,请访问其它页面或直接与我们联系。

    42030

    CNCF调查:云原生技术在生产中使用增长了200%以上

    Kubernetes 58%受访者在生产中使用Kubernetes,42%受访者在评估未来使用。相比之下,40%企业公司(5000+)在生产中使用Kubernetes。...在生产中,40%受访者运行2-5个集群、1个集群(22%)、6-10个集群(14%)和50多个集群(从9%上升到13%)。...隔离Kubernetes应用程序 受访者使用名称空间(78%)、单独集群(50%)和只使用标签(21%)来分隔Kubernetes应用程序在生产中使用云原生 云原生项目有哪些好处?...- Minio:27%受访者正在生产中使用,而73%(从28%上升)正在评估。 - OpenSDS:16%(从7%上升)受访者正在生产中使用,而84%(从14%上升)正在评估。...- REX-Ray:18%受访者正在生产中使用,而82%受访者正在评估。 - Openstorage:19%(从31%下降)受访者正在生产中使用,而81%(从36%上升)正在评估。

    1.2K70

    在生产中使用Rust著名公司及他们选择Rust理由

    他们在 GitHub 上展示了 18 个使用 Rust 开源仓库,在他们博客上记录了使用 Rust 开发防火墙规则文档,这是一个可灵活定制防火墙工具。...Rust 在编译时可检测出大量严重错误,一个错误在编译时造成损失要比在生产时少几个数量级。 Amazon AWS 已经在 Lambda、EC2 和 S3 等对性能敏感服务组件上使用了 Rust。...虽然 Go 版本服务在大多数情况下性能已经足够快了,但由于 Go 内存模型和垃圾收集器缺陷,它有时会出现较大延迟峰值。...Rust 未来 以上提到大多数公司,Rust 都作为了 C 语言一个更好替代方案,用 Rust 进行重写,可以避免性能下降。...当团队需要更优性能,但又想避免与 C 相关内存问题时,他们就会选择使用 Rust。

    85720

    如何提高Flutter应用程序性能

    老孟导读:首先 Flutter 是一个非常高性能框架,因此大多时候不需要开发者做出特殊处理,只需要避免常见性能问题即可获得高性能应用程序。..._SwitchWidget 和 Switch 组件,提高了性能。...(key: GlobalKey(),), Container(), ], ), ); } } 虽然通过 GlobalKey 提高了上面案例性能...将内容绘制到屏幕外缓冲区中可能会触发渲染目标切换,这在较早GPU中特别慢。 另外虽然下面这些组件比较消耗性能,但并不是禁止大家使用,而是谨慎使用,如果有替代方案,考虑使用替代方法。...这些组件中都有 clipBehavior 属性,不同性能是不同, /// * [hardEdge], which is the fastest clipping, but with lower

    1.5K10

    Java应用程序性能优化技巧

    Java 应用程序性能优化是一个常见技术难题。...要提高 Java 应用程序性能,需要综合考虑以下几个方面: 1、内存管理和垃圾收集 Java 使用自动内存管理和垃圾收集机制,在处理大量数据或长时间运行时,可能会影响整体性能。...文件读写、网络调用等都有潜在延迟,并可能成为应用程序瓶颈原因。通过使用缓冲技术、选择异步 NIO 或选择优化网络库,可以提高 IO 操作性能。...7、JVM 参数调整 Java 应用程序运行时参数调整幅度相对较大,通过了解和调整 JVM 内存和线程设置和堆栈大小以及调整垃圾收集器等都可提高性能。...还应根据特定场景和应用程序需求进行优化,仔细监控和评估性能和行为变化。

    16740

    LoggerMessageAttribute 高性能日志记录

    使用时,它会以source-generators方式生成高性能日志记录 API。 source-generators可在编译代码时,可以提供其他源代码作为编译输入。...触发后,它既可以自动生成其修饰 partial 方法实现,也可以生成包含正确用法提示编译时诊断。 与现有的日志记录方法相比,编译时日志记录解决方案在运行时通常要快得多。...真实记录日志代码生成器在编译时触发,并生成 partial 方法实现。...日志记录方法名称不得以下划线开头。 日志记录方法参数名称不得以下划线开头。 日志记录方法不得在嵌套类型中定义。 日志记录方法不能是泛型方法。...允许按原样传递所有原始数据,在对其进行处理之前,不需要进行任何复杂存储(除了创建 string)。 提供特定于日志记录诊断,针对重复事件 ID 发出警告。

    8610

    Freddy:一款基于活动被动扫描方式Java&.NET应用程序漏洞扫描工具

    Freddy是一款开源工具,该工具功能基于主动/被动式扫描,在Freddy帮助下,研究人员可以快速查找Java和.NET应用程序反序列化安全问题。...该插件实现了主动式和被动式扫描这两种方式,可以识别并利用目标代码库中安全漏洞。...功能介绍 被动式扫描 Freddy可以通过识别类型标识符、HTTP请求签名或HTTP响应来被动检测目标代码库或API中潜在序列化/反序列化漏洞。...基于异常检测 在基于异常主动扫描过程中,Freddy会向HTTP请求中注入测试数据,并尝试触发异常或错误信息。如果在目标应用程序所返回响应信息中观察到了错误信息,那么就说明这里存在安全问题。...Freddy每隔60秒就会检查一次Collaborator问题反馈,并以下列形式将问题记录在日志文件中。

    1.6K10

    Kubernetes生产环境最佳实践

    Gartner预测,到2022年,超过75%全球组织将在生产中运行集装箱应用程序,而目前这一比例还不到30%。...到2025年,超过85%全球组织将在生产中推动集装箱应用,较2019年不到35%有显著增长。...集群监控和日志记录 在使用Kubernetes时,监控部署是至关重要。确保配置、性能和流量保持安全更是重要。如果不进行日志记录和监控,就不可能诊断出发生问题。...为了确保合规性,监视和日志记录变得非常重要。 在进行监视时,有必要在体系结构每一层上设置日志记录功能。生成日志将帮助我们启用安全工具、审计功能和分析性能。...由于许多公司都在生产中使用Kubernetes,因此必须遵循上面提到最佳实践,以顺利和可靠地扩展应用程序

    58820

    Kubernetes生产环境最佳实践

    Gartner预测,到2022年,超过75%全球组织将在生产中运行集装箱应用程序,而目前这一比例还不到30%。...到2025年,超过85%全球组织将在生产中推动集装箱应用,较2019年不到35%有显著增长。...集群监控和日志记录 在使用Kubernetes时,监控部署是至关重要。确保配置、性能和流量保持安全更是重要。如果不进行日志记录和监控,就不可能诊断出发生问题。...为了确保合规性,监视和日志记录变得非常重要。 ? 在进行监视时,有必要在体系结构每一层上设置日志记录功能。生成日志将帮助我们启用安全工具、审计功能和分析性能。...由于许多公司都在生产中使用Kubernetes,因此必须遵循上面提到最佳实践,以顺利和可靠地扩展应用程序

    1.7K30

    Kubernetes 生产环境最佳实践

    Gartner预测,到2022年,超过75%全球组织将在生产中运行集装箱应用程序,而目前这一比例还不到30%。...到2025年,超过85%全球组织将在生产中推动集装箱应用,较2019年不到35%有显著增长。...集群监控和日志记录 在使用Kubernetes时,监控部署是至关重要。确保配置、性能和流量保持安全更是重要。如果不进行日志记录和监控,就不可能诊断出发生问题。...为了确保合规性,监视和日志记录变得非常重要。 在进行监视时,有必要在体系结构每一层上设置日志记录功能。生成日志将帮助我们启用安全工具、审计功能和分析性能。...由于许多公司都在生产中使用Kubernetes,因此必须遵循上面提到最佳实践,以顺利和可靠地扩展应用程序

    21410

    k8s 生产环境最佳实践

    Gartner预测,到2022年,超过75%全球组织将在生产中运行集装箱应用程序,而目前这一比例还不到30%。...图片 另一个好实践是将k8s环境划分为不同团队、部门、应用程序和客户机独立名称空间; 2.3 k8s资源使用情况 Kubernetes资源使用指的是容器/pod在生产中所使用资源数量...2.9 集群监控和日志记录 在使用Kubernetes时,监控部署是至关重要。确保配置、性能和流量保持安全更是重要。如果不进行日志记录和监控,就不可能诊断出发生问题。...为了确保合规性,监视和日志记录变得非常重要。 图片 在进行监视时,有必要在体系结构每一层上设置日志记录功能。生成日志将帮助我们启用安全工具、审计功能和分析性能。...由于许多公司都在生产中使用Kubernetes,因此必须遵循上面提到最佳实践,以顺利和可靠地扩展应用程序

    1.5K10

    TikTok 应用程序日志都记录了什么内容?

    (TikTok: Logs, Logs, Logs) 中,我对 TikTok 发出 app_log 网络请求内容进行了解密。 完成解密后,有一个问题仍然存在: 事件记录。...我需要仔细研究一下他们认为“事件”是什么,但就我所知,这似乎是一个相当标准分析解决方案。 在本文中,我将回答以下问题:TikTok 应用程序日志定义是什么?...3 什么是 TikTok 应用程序日志? 我们起点是 app_log 这一关键字。为了解 TikTok 是如何处理应用程序日志,我对应用程序进行了反编译,并分析了源代码。...TikTok 应用程序日志可以是 LogEvent、LogPage 或 LogSession。 4 这些应用程序日志(实际上)里面有什么?...通过这种方法,我得到了 TikTok 在使用应用程序时创建所有应用程序日志详细信息。下面是日志会话、日志事件和日志以及杂项日志示例。

    1.2K10

    生产环境中进行自动化测试

    其次在使用在线Selenium Grid在生产中执行自动浏览器测试可以帮助您清除维护内部Selenium Grid所花费主要时间障碍,并跨不同操作系统/设备/浏览器分别测试Web应用程序功能。...这可以帮助您确保在生产中验证产品跨浏览器兼容性。 决不能忽视生产中硒测试自动化。让我们看一下测试自动化在生产中好处。...测试自动化在生产中优势 到目前为止,我们知道在生产中测试 Web 应用程序变得势在必行。但是我们需要自动化它吗?Selenium测试自动化有什么好处,让我们看一看。...然后可以进一步分析哪个版本性能更好,基于您保留性能更好版本。 自动回滚策略 在此策略中,每当发现故障时,服务仍处于监视阶段时,都会将应用程序返回到以前稳定版本。...正确实现后,回滚可以帮助您实现以前稳定应用状态,但实现不佳可能会导致数据丢失。 总而言之 生产中测试主要议程是确保应用程序在生产环境中稳定。

    1K10

    如何用OpenNJet部署自己应用程序?——OpenNJet实践记录

    OpenNJet部署自己应用程序。...二、配置与部署应用程序下面使用OpenNJet 来配置一个简单 HTTP 服务器,并搭建自己应用程序上去。...(也可以修改,可以将打包好应用程序放在服务器上任何位置,只要正确设置 root 目录即可。)...输入服务器IP地址或域名即可访问Web应用程序:此外,还可以根据需要进行修改和定制,比如在实际部署 Web 应用程序时,使用 OpenNJet 进行动态配置在不中断服务情况下实时更改 Web 服务器配置...首先OpenNJet通过动态配置能力解决了性能无损动态配置问题,能够无需重新启动服务器,快速响应流量需求变化;其次,OpenNJetCoPilot框架不仅实现了高性能数据处理能力,还提供了方便扩展管理接口

    15910
    领券